John Porter began writing in 2005 about martial arts and life in the military while serving in the U.S. Army. He has worked as a media correspondent for George Mason University. His work appears in the university's newspaper, "The Broadside," and on the websites connect2mason.com and Through the Cage.

Porter enjoys learning new languages and training in Brazilian Jiu-Jitsu as well as Muay Thai. He is regularly found cageside at mixed martial arts events serving as a photographer.
